Stunning sun halo towers above homes in Indonesia
This is the spectacular moment a stunning halo appeared above homes in Indonesia.
Residents spotted the circular rainbow-like phenomenon in the clear blue sky over Batam, Riau Islands Province, on Monday, August 25, at around 10 am.
Ramlan Djambak, head of the Meteorology, Climatology and Geophysics Agency (BMKG) at Hang Nadim Batam Meteorological Station, said: 'The halo phenomenon occurs when sunlight is reflected and refracted by thin cirrus clouds.'
Cirrus clouds are high-altitude clouds made of ice crystals that can bend light under certain conditions.
Djambak said that the effect is similar to the way dew reflects light in the morning.
He added: 'If the cirrus clouds are evenly spread, the halo will appear clearly. But if the clouds are thick and hold a lot of water vapour, the circular outline will be blocked.'
The spectacle was visible across Batam and possibly in nearby areas, including Tanjungpinang and Bintan.
